Mr. M is a 68- year-old male patient with a past medical history of diabetes mellitus type II and severe ischemic cardiomyopathy. he reported that for 6 weeks he had been experiencing shortness of breath and fatigue with moderate activity, difficulty sleeping at night, and has a weight gain of 5 pounds, even though he described his appetite as poor. There is no evidence of smoking or illegal drug use. Upon examination, the practitioner noted periorbital edema and bi lateral 4 pitting edema in both lower extremities. His present weight is 154 lbs (pounds) and his vital signs are BP 160/100, T 98.4, P 104, and R 28. Mr. M was administered for intravenous support and aggressive diuresis. Physician ordered micro-k 10 extencaps (Potassium chloride) 20mEq PO daily. How many milliequivalents of the electrolyte supplements micro-K will the patient have received after 5 days of therapy?
